Yoda, osobní asistent příkazového řádku Gnu / Linux

o yodě

V příštím článku se podíváme na osobního asistenta Yodu. Našel jsem ten, který hledá skvělé věci na GitHubu. Jak říkám, Yoda je osobní asistent příkazového řádku což nám může pomoci provádět triviální úkoly na Gnu / Linux. Je to bezplatná aplikace s otevřeným zdrojovým kódem napsaná v Pythonu.

Je třeba říci, že je vhodné otestovat Yodu ve virtuálním prostředí. Nejen Yoda, ale jakákoli aplikace v Pythonu, aby nezasahovala do globálně nainstalovaných balíčků. Yoda vyžaduje Python 2 a PIP. Pokud na vašem Ubuntu není nainstalován PIP, můžete to zkontrolovat článek, který jsme publikovali v tomto blogu Trvalo nějakou dobu, než se toho zmocnili.

Nainstalujte si Yodu, osobního asistenta z příkazového řádku

Jakmile máme v našem systému nainstalovaný PIP, k získání programu použijeme git clone. Budeme muset otevřít pouze terminál (Ctrl + Alt + T) a napsat:

git clone https://github.com/yoda-pa/yoda

Výše uvedený příkaz vytvoří adresář s názvem „yoda“ v našem aktuálním pracovním adresáři a naklonuje do něj veškerý obsah. Přejdeme do adresáře yoda:

cd yoda/

Dále provedeme následující příkaz do nainstalujte aplikaci Yoda:

pip install .

mošt zvážit tečka (.) na konci předchozího příkazu.

Nakonfigurujte Yodu

Nejprve spustíme konfiguraci pro uložit naše informace v místním systému. Chcete-li tak učinit, spusťte:

yoda setup new

Předchozí objednávka nás donutí odpovědět na následující otázky:

Yoda vytvořit nastavení

Naše heslo bude uloženo v šifrovaný konfigurační soubor, takže se nemusíte obávat. Ve výchozím nastavení budou naše informace uloženy v adresáři ~ / .yoda.

na zkontrolujte aktuální konfiguraci, spustit:

yoda setup check

na odstranit existující konfiguraci, budeme muset pouze psát do terminálu (Ctrl + Alt + T):

yoda setup delete

Použití Yody

Kdo chce, může vědět vše, co může tento průvodce pro uživatele udělat ve svém Stránka GitHub. Následuje seznam některých věcí, které můžeme s Yodou dělat.

Chatujte s Yodou

Budeme moci komunikovat základním způsobem s programem pomocí příkazu chat, jak je uvedeno níže:

Yoda, kdo jsi

yoda chat who are you?

Otestujte si rychlost internetu

Na Yodu se budeme moci zeptat rychlost internetu. Chcete-li tak učinit, spusťte:

Speed ​​test Yoda

yoda speedtest

Zkraťte a rozbalte URL

Yoda také pomáhá zkrátit jakoukoli adresu URL psát něco jako:

Yoda URL se zkrátí

yoda url shorten https://ubunlog.com

na rozbalte zkrácenou adresu URL napíšeme:

Yoda URL rozbalit

yoda url expand https://goo.gl/Pn1EeU

Přečtěte si zprávy z Hacker News

já obvykle podívejte se na web Hacker News. Každý, kdo chce, si může přečíst zprávy na této stránce pomocí aplikace Yoda, jak je uvedeno níže:

Novinky Yoda Hackera

yoda hackernews

Yoda ukáže jedna novinka najednou. Chcete-li si přečíst další zprávy, zadejte „y“ a stiskněte klávesu Enter.

Spravujte osobní deníky

Yoda deník

  1. Můžeme také vést osobní deník pro zaznamenávání důležitých událostí. Pro vytvořit nový deník použijeme příkaz:
yoda diary nn
  1. Chcete-li vytvořit novou poznámku, budete muset provést předchozí příkaz. Pokud chceme zobrazit všechny poznámky napíšeme:
yoda diary notes
  1. Budeme nejen schopni psát poznámky. Yoda nám také může pomoci vytvářet úkoly. Pro vytvořit nový úkol, provedeme:
yoda diary nt
  1. na zobrazit seznam úkolů, do terminálu napíšeme:
yoda diary tasks
  1. Pokud ano úkol jako nedokončený, provedeme následující příkaz k napsání sériového čísla úkolu k jeho dokončení:
yoda diary ct
  1. Budeme moci analyzovat úkoly pro aktuální měsíc kdykoli pomocí příkazu:
yoda diary analyze

Dělejte si poznámky o našich kontaktech

Nejprve musíme spustit konfiguraci pro ukládat podrobnosti o našich kontaktech. Chcete-li tak učinit, spusťte:

yoda love setup

Zde budeme psát podrobnosti o našem kontaktu:

yoda láska nastavení

Abychom je viděli údaje o osobě, spustit:

yoda love status

na přidat narozeniny kontaktu píše:

Yoda miluje zrození

yoda love addbirth

Sledujte peněžní výdaje

K tomu nebudeme potřebovat samostatný nástroj kontrolovat naše finanční výdaje. Můžeme to udělat s Yodou. Nejprve spustíme konfiguraci pro řízení peněžních výdajů pomocí příkazu:

yoda money setup

Zde napíšeme náš kód měny a počáteční částka:

Nastavení peněz Yoda

Naučte se slovní zásobu angličtiny

To je dobré pro znalost slov v angličtině, ačkoli definice budeme mít také v angličtině. Yoda nám pomůže naučte se náhodná slova v angličtině a sledovat náš postup učení.

Abychom se naučili nové slovo, napíšeme:

Slovo slovníku Yoda

yoda vocabulary word

To nám ukáže náhodné slovo. Stisknutím klávesy Enter zobrazíte význam slova. Yoda se nás zeptá, jestli už známe význam slova.

pomoci

Navíc vám Yoda může pomoci dělat jiné věci, například najít definici slova a vytvořit kartičky, které vám pomohou snadno se cokoli naučit. Pro získejte více podrobností a seznam dostupných možností, viz část nápovědy zadáním:

Nápověda Yoda

yoda --help

Zanechte svůj komentář

Vaše e-mailová adresa nebude zveřejněna. Povinné položky jsou označeny *

*

*

  1. Odpovědný za údaje: Miguel Ángel Gatón
  2. Účel údajů: Ovládací SPAM, správa komentářů.
  3. Legitimace: Váš souhlas
  4. Sdělování údajů: Údaje nebudou sděleny třetím osobám, s výjimkou zákonných povinností.
  5. Úložiště dat: Databáze hostovaná společností Occentus Networks (EU)
  6. Práva: Vaše údaje můžete kdykoli omezit, obnovit a odstranit.

  1.   Leonardo Figueiredo Camara řekl

    Fabio Neves

  2.   David Aviles Espinola řekl

    S Puchou máme problém s týmem s UBUNTU

  3.   Římské guazo řekl

    Dobrý vstup, nějakou dobu jsem hledal něco podobného, ​​ale

    Co se stane, když si jej nainstaluji na svůj ubuntu a ne do virtuálního prostředí? něco ovlivnit?

    Jediná věc, kterou chci s YODA udělat, je vést časopis, protože se mi nelíbí RedNoetebook, a proto jsou záznamy poněkud dlouhé. Mohu to udělat s YODA?

    Pokud se mi nelíbí, jak jej mohu odinstalovat?

  4.   Damian Amoedo řekl

    Myslím, že řešení vašich pochybností najdete na stránce projektu GitHub https://github.com/yoda-pa/yoda. ahoj 2.